Transaction 27745f3a05d51a8138a62b23a1621a05176e22416c8d76817fbd0463b6e8d09b

2 Input
2 Outputs
  • 27745f3a05d51a8138a62b23a1621a05176e22416c8d76817fbd0463b6e8d09b:0
  • value  905278
    address  1Ka8badMsgxq7pcaEJ55EEhZemMXnUgsN6
  • 27745f3a05d51a8138a62b23a1621a05176e22416c8d76817fbd0463b6e8d09b:1
  • value  347800
    address  1EZDBj1cBK1vJbeRAQrGEzqPDs3brysehE